Geographic Location of Chikkonahalli


The village Chikkonahalli is located in Kunigal Taluk of Tumakuru District in the State of Karnataka in India. It is governed by Chowdanakuppe Gram Panchayat. It comes under Kunigal Community Development Block. The nearest town is Kunigal, which is about 23 kilometers away from Chikkonahalli.

Travel and Communication for Chikkonahalli


The village is connected by public bus services. Private buses services are available for the village. There is a railway station more than 10 kms away from the village.

Social Structure of Chikkonahalli


As per available data from the year 2009, 558 persons live in 136 house holds in the village Chikkonahalli. There are 282 female individuals and 276 male individuals in the village. Females constitute 50.54% and males constitute 49.46% of the total population.

There are 123 scheduled castes persons of which 54 are females and 69 are males. Females constitute 43.9% and males constitute 56.1% of the scheduled castes population. Scheduled castes constitute 22.04% of the total population.

There are 36 scheduled tribes persons of which 19 are females and 17 are males. Females constitute 52.78% and males constitute 47.22% of the scheduled tribes population. Scheduled tribes constitute 6.45% of the total population.

Population density of Chikkonahalli is 566.21 persons per square kilometer.

Land and Natural Resources in Chikkonahalli

Total area of Chikkonahalli is 98.55 Hectares as per the data available for the year 2009.

Total sown/agricultural area is 73.69 ha. About 67.32 ha is un-irrigated area. About 6.37 ha is irrigated area. About 6.37 ha is irrigated by wells/tube wells.

About 3.38 ha is in non-agricultural use. About 16.18 ha is used permanent pastures and grazing lands. About 0.36 ha is under miscellaneous tree crops.

About 4.94 ha is covered by barren and un-cultivable land.

Schools in Chikkonahalli


There is a government pre-primary school in the village Chikkonahalli.

There is a government primary school in the village Chikkonahalli.

There are no private or government middle schools in the village. However, there is a private middle school in Madappanahalli, which is less than 5 kms away from Chikkonahalli.

There are no private or government secondary schools in the village. However, there is a private secondary school in Ankanahalli, which is 5-10 kms away from Chikkonahalli.

There are no private or government senior secondary schools in the village. However, there is a private senior secondary school in Chowdanakuppe, which is less than 5 kms away from Chikkonahalli.
